Commit Graph

46 Commits

Author SHA1 Message Date
NI
7d2e5491d9 Trigger more Terminal Console "Resize". Hope it'll fix some tricky problems 2020-07-16 10:05:17 +08:00
NI
3ec9669057 Refixed tabIndex on the connector window with a better method 2020-05-18 23:31:31 +08:00
NI
f0a289f836 Code clean up for screen_console.vue 2020-05-18 23:04:28 +08:00
NI
d7b9a8e437 Fixed tabIndex on the connector page. Tab key should work as expected now. 2020-05-18 17:38:18 +08:00
NI
55b570f2c9 Add padding around the remote import tip 2020-02-08 10:42:59 +08:00
NI
67c99e3092 Implemented the host name auto suggestion, and added Preset feature 2020-02-07 21:34:16 +08:00
NI
0a930d1345 Fixed tabindex and add support for input suggestion to Connector Wizard 2020-02-07 18:02:27 +08:00
NI
ed2f8157ad Add refreash animation for "Known remotes" import screen 2019-12-31 09:30:35 +08:00
NI
e75ebed269 Allowing "Known remotes" to be import and exported 2019-12-30 18:44:01 +08:00
NI
b5ebe6759c Update copyright date to 2020. Happy new year! 2019-12-29 14:11:54 +08:00
NI
0c8db2d243 Adjust console font resize interface for easier access, and make min-allowed font size to 8 2019-12-15 16:44:19 +08:00
NI
f190cefe33 Better code (callback -> async) and protection aganist early tab close (Close before terminal is loaded) 2019-12-15 14:55:13 +08:00
NI
8bdfbeb7b9 Use inherited fonts before Hack is completely loaded 2019-12-14 10:12:15 +08:00
NI
c018c7b4be Further improve the remote font intergation: Better preload strategy, better loading and UI interation. 2019-12-13 14:44:13 +08:00
NI
19473ae161 Add text resize feature, and change font of console screen to Hack. 2019-12-12 16:45:55 +08:00
NI
c572c2a688 Fixed the connecting animation 2019-12-07 21:41:58 +08:00
NI
7caa245df0 Correctly use the new xterm onBinary callback 2019-12-06 22:48:34 +08:00
NI
6a84c7494d Upgrade front-end dependencies and change code to use xterm 4.3.0 2019-12-06 18:54:16 +08:00
NI
e048671bfd Session data can be cleared without reloading the page 2019-10-22 08:38:31 +08:00
NI
8acab466d7 Upgrade front-end dependencies 2019-10-18 10:18:23 +08:00
NI
f2f2c4352d Connection status charts now use different color to distinguish statistics of current connection from past ones 2019-10-02 23:16:53 +08:00
NI
cf6dfaf784 Refuse console input when the terminal is closed 2019-10-01 15:52:43 +08:00
NI
5e32228960 Adjust Connection Status panel, stop updating when the connection is closed 2019-10-01 15:45:28 +08:00
NI
b54b0d250b Fix style of the connector warning icon 2019-09-27 09:47:45 +08:00
NI
3b8483f9c5 Use document.title to display tab count and update info 2019-09-27 09:39:18 +08:00
NI
9804af7219 Remove onData debug logger, as it is no longer needed 2019-09-19 15:11:10 +08:00
NI
eefdece1d2 Overlay should cover the entire pop window 2019-09-15 14:29:00 +08:00
NI
2521bcbd52 Fix a weird element placement 2019-09-15 09:36:37 +08:00
NI
5497a3d66a Upgrade to xtermjs 4 2019-09-14 23:28:10 +08:00
NI
6b5c444f45 Allowing user to customly setup server charset when connecting to a Telnet host 2019-09-14 15:20:50 +08:00
NI
659468006b Adjust font size of hot key bar titles. 2019-09-13 16:49:01 +08:00
NI
6585810cc4 Add on screen control for some hot keys. To toggle it, click/tap currently opened tab. 2019-09-11 11:31:08 +08:00
NI
c5927a5b5d Adjust common.css 2019-09-10 19:11:20 +08:00
NI
797f4fd89c Add retap triggers, which is currently no use 2019-09-09 22:52:06 +08:00
NI
d16423e4ac Adjust style of the "Known remotes" list 2019-08-30 06:56:27 +08:00
NI
c815f73e7a Save credential (Password and private key etc) in webpage memory. 2019-08-29 22:47:20 +08:00
NI
6d349f133e SSH: Change the input box type for Private Key field from textarea to file. 2019-08-29 21:27:43 +08:00
NI
e82722d424 Verify all no need to be async. 2019-08-29 16:12:12 +08:00
NI
9257bd40c3 Wrap buildCurrent in try in case of unknown errors + verify no need to be async. 2019-08-27 21:10:21 +08:00
NI
fcfcb25b6b Fix busy.svg 2019-08-27 18:40:11 +08:00
NI
55f40b7214 Get 20% more safety at notypotoday.dev. Start your free trial today! 2019-08-20 13:51:48 +08:00
NI
6ddcb00b24 Image compression has caused some issue in the busy.svg. The problem still waiting to be resolved, but I modified the image to ease the damage. 2019-08-14 12:09:54 +08:00
NI
0d5fa2e910 Typo fix, change secrects to secrets
https://www.reddit.com/r/golang/comments/cp8h41/hey_i_made_a_web_ssh_client_with_go_js_and_vue/ewpgog3?utm_source=share&utm_medium=web2x
2019-08-13 07:53:12 +08:00
NI
0d635e967b Change wording. 2019-08-12 15:21:56 +08:00
NI
9f5b2364c7 Added copy & paste hot key (Control+Shift+C / Control+Shift+V). Only work on supported web broswers. 2019-08-12 11:04:02 +08:00
NI
02f14eb14f Initial commit 2019-08-07 15:56:51 +08:00